Transaction eea71d52bc86dab69ade66015abbfe25ca7af9ec3a2bad752afed1ec16a5f61a
1 Input
1 Output
-
eea71d52bc86dab69ade66015abbfe25ca7af9ec3a2bad752afed1ec16a5f61a:0
- value
- 597971
- script pubkey
- OP_0 OP_PUSHBYTES_20 23700a9855f014ceaec2a4262ceb42b7319de112
- address
- bc1qydcq4xz47q2vatkz5snze66zkucemcgjldjv6l